Transaction d730590766c72497638539f18c9661b5f21c46cd36721e4bf3662ab45aa920a8

1 Input
2 Outputs
  • d730590766c72497638539f18c9661b5f21c46cd36721e4bf3662ab45aa920a8:0
  • value  32500000
    address  2ND3wjkMnTACCskdBKzHFhTskXCzwadEBv8
  • d730590766c72497638539f18c9661b5f21c46cd36721e4bf3662ab45aa920a8:1
  • value  142389080
    address  2N87YufCj4BNJoz5y4LjHk8AmjdpubNKPPt